Unveiling Music Distribution Deal Contracts
Navigating the intricate world of music distribution can be tricky, especially when facing contracts that seem like a foreign language. These agreements establish the terms by which your music will be distributed to platforms like Spotify, Apple Music, and others. It's vital to comprehend these contracts before signing as they can materially impact your revenue.
We'll delve into some key components to look for:
* **Royalties:** This is the portion of revenue you get from each stream or sale of your music. Make sure you understand how royalties are determined.
* **Advance Payment:** Some distributors offer an upfront payment against future royalties. Be clear of any refundable clauses.
* **Term Length:** The contract defines the duration for which the agreement is in effect.
It's strongly to seek advice from a music lawyer before agreeing to any distribution deal. They can help you negotiate favorable terms and protect your rights.

Essential Clauses for a Fair Music Distribution Deal Contract
A fair music distribution deal contract must outline the terms and conditions clearly in order to that both the artist and the distributor are protected. Here are some essential clauses to consider carefully:
- Possession of Master Recordings: This clause defines who controls the master recordings of the music, providing the artist complete rights.
- Compensation: This clause outlines how royalties are calculated, including the percentage of revenue the artist will receive. It's important to bargain a fair royalty model.
- Term of the Agreement: This clause specifies the length of the contract, ranging from a few years to an indefinite period. Be sure to understand the commitments involved.
- Limitations: This clause clarifies whether the agreement is exclusive or non-exclusive, affecting where the artist can distribute their music.
- Dissolution Clause: This clause defines the conditions under which the contract can be terminated by either party, including any fees involved.
It's crucial to meticulously review each clause with an attorney concentrating in music law to ensure that the contract is fair and protects your benefits.
